windows git failed to connect to address not available
时间: 2023-05-08 12:59:08 浏览: 58
这个错误提示通常出现在使用git时连接远程仓库或者执行Push、Pull等操作时,由于网络或者其他原因造成无法连接到目标地址而导致的。解决这个问题,可以尝试以下几种方法:
1、检查网络是否正常连接,并确保网络流量、DNS解析等方面的问题没有影响到git的使用;
2、检查仓库地址是否正确,是否需要使用SSH证书等访问方式,确保认证信息正确;
3、尝试更换git版本,或者修改git的一些配置参数,比如缩短连接超时时间、增加重试次数等;
4、如果使用的是git desktop客户端,可以尝试重新登录账号或者升级客户端版本;
5、最后还可以尝试联系管理员检查git服务器的运行状态,是否存在故障或者维护等问题。总之,要解决这个问题需要综合考虑多种因素,并进行逐一排查,找到原因所在,并采取相应的解决方案。
相关问题
unable to access ...git failed to connect
当我们在使用Git时,有时会遇到"unable to access ...git failed to connect"的错误。这个错误通常会出现在我们尝试连接远程Git仓库时,但连接失败的情况下。
出现这个错误的原因可能有几种。首先,我们需要确认网络连接是否正常。如果我们的网络连接不稳定或者受限制,可能会导致无法连接到Git仓库。我们可以尝试通过访问其他网站或者使用其他网络连接来检查网络是否正常工作。
其次,我们需要确认是否正确配置了Git仓库的远程地址。在使用Git时,我们需要将远程Git仓库的地址配置到本地仓库中。如果我们配置的地址不正确或者被防火墙或代理服务器阻止,就无法连接到远程仓库。我们可以检查配置文件中的远程地址是否正确,或者尝试使用其他工具(如浏览器)来测试连接远程仓库的地址是否可用。
另外,一些安全软件或防火墙也可能阻止Git连接到远程仓库。这是因为安全软件可能会将Git标记为潜在的风险或恶意软件。我们可以尝试关闭或调整安全软件的设置,以允许Git连接到远程仓库。
最后,有时候Git服务器本身可能出现故障或者维护。在这种情况下,我们无法通过任何方法来解决这个问题,只能等待服务器恢复正常。
总之,"unable to access ...git failed to connect"错误可能是由网络连接问题、配置错误、安全软件或服务器故障等原因引起的。我们可以通过检查网络连接、确认配置信息、调整防火墙或安全软件,并等待服务器恢复来尝试解决这个问题。
git failed to push some refs to
git failed to push some refs to是在使用git进行推送操作时出现的错误。一般情况下,这个错误是由于你在推送之前有其他人提交了代码,并且你没有将其同步到你的本地库所导致的。解决这个问题的办法是先拉取最新的代码,然后再进行提交。
具体操作如下:
1. 执行`git pull --rebase origin <branch-name>`命令,将远程库中最新的代码同步到你的本地库。
2. 再执行`git push origin <branch-name>`命令,将你的代码推送到远程库。
如果在拉取代码时出现提示要先提交本地的更改,那么你需要先将本地的更改提交完毕,然后再执行`git pull`命令拉取远程代码。
现在,你可以尝试重新提交你的代码了。使用以下命令进行提交操作:`git push origin <branch-name>`。